Résumé

Mac OS X v.10.2 is designed to enable anyone from digital media hobbyist to mid-level professionals take advantage of the amazing capabilities of Apple's suite of digital media tools. iLife is published by Apple, retails for $49, and combines iTunes for managing music, iPhoto for digital photography, iMovie for editing digital video and iDVD for creating your own DVDs.

Features

  • Includes sections dedicated to each of the iLife applications - iMovie, iPhoto, iDVD, and iTunes - plus a section covering a wide variety of digital projects and special techniques.
  • Provides lots of explanatory material to help readers understand the technology and applications while the Step-by-Step elements guide them through specific tasks.
  • Explain and compares alternate ways to accomplish tasks to help readers select the best techniques for their own projects.
  • Uses a holistic approach to the digital media tools and emphasizes how these tools work together.

L'auteur - Brad Miser

Brad Miser has written extensively about computers and related technology, with his favorite topics being anything that starts with a lowercase i, such as the iPod and iTunes. In addition to Absolute Beginner's Guide to the iPod and iTunes, Brad has written many other books, including Special Edition Using Mac OS X, v10.3 Panther; Mac OS X and iLife: Using iTunes, iPhoto, iMovie, and iDVD; iDVD 3 Fast & Easy; Special Edition Using Mac OS X v10.2, Mac OS X and the Digital Lifestyle; and Using Mac OS 8.5. He has also been an author, development editor, or technical editor on more than 50 other titles. He has been a featured speaker on various computer-related topics at Macworld Expo, at user group meetings and in other venues.
